是指在Flask框架中,通过应用程序调度程序实现并发运行多个作业的功能。应用程序调度程序是一种用于管理和调度作业的工具,它可以根据一定的规则和策略,将多个作业分配给不同的处理器或线程进行并发执行,以提高系统的处理能力和效率。
在Flask中,可以使用多种方式实现应用程序调度程序,例如使用多线程、多进程、协程等技术。这些技术可以根据具体的需求和场景选择合适的方式进行并发运行作业。
优势:
- 提高系统的处理能力:通过并发运行多个作业,可以充分利用系统的资源,提高系统的处理能力和吞吐量。
- 提高用户体验:并发运行作业可以减少用户等待时间,提高系统的响应速度,从而提升用户体验。
- 提高系统的稳定性:通过将作业分配给不同的处理器或线程进行并发执行,可以降低系统的单点故障风险,提高系统的稳定性和可靠性。
应用场景:
- Web应用程序:在Web应用程序中,可以使用应用程序调度程序实现并发处理用户请求,提高系统的并发能力和响应速度。
- 后台任务处理:在后台任务处理中,可以使用应用程序调度程序并发运行多个任务,提高任务处理的效率和速度。
- 数据处理和分析:在数据处理和分析领域,可以使用应用程序调度程序并发运行多个数据处理任务,加快数据处理和分析的速度。
推荐的腾讯云相关产品:
腾讯云提供了多个与应用程序调度相关的产品和服务,例如:
- 云服务器(CVM):腾讯云的云服务器提供了高性能的计算资源,可以用于并发运行作业的部署和执行。
- 弹性容器实例(Elastic Container Instance,ECI):腾讯云的弹性容器实例提供了轻量级的容器运行环境,可以快速部署和运行应用程序。
- 云函数(Serverless Cloud Function,SCF):腾讯云的云函数是一种无服务器计算服务,可以实现按需运行作业的功能。
- 批量计算(BatchCompute):腾讯云的批量计算服务提供了高性能的计算资源,可以用于并发运行大规模作业。
以上是腾讯云相关产品的简介,更详细的产品信息和介绍可以参考腾讯云官方网站:https://cloud.tencent.com/